| ⇢ | A | TempFileStream added | |
| A | ↛ | ConnectionHeader removed | |
| A | ↛ | ContentLocationHeader removed | |
| A | ↛ | ContentMD5Header removed | |
| A | ↛ | ExpiresHeader removed | |
| A | ↛ | KeepAliveHeader removed | |
| A | ↛ | AccessControlAllowHeadersHeader removed | |
| A | ↛ | TransferEncodingHeader removed | |
| A | ↛ | WarningHeader removed | |
| A | ↛ | DateHeader removed | |
| A | ↛ | ContentSecurityPolicyReportOnlyHeader removed | |
| ⋮ | view more | ||
| ⇢ | A | TempFileStream::__construct() added | |
| ⇢ | A | User::create() added | |
| ⇢ | A | Password::create() added | |
| A | ↘ | B | server_request_files() got worse |
| B | ↛ | SetCookieHeader::getFieldValue() removed | |
| B | ↛ | Header::validateParametersByRegex() removed | |
| A | ↛ | SetCookieHeader::__construct() removed | |
| A | ↛ | ContentSecurityPolicyHeader::getFieldValue() removed | |
| A | ↛ | AccessControlAllowMethodsHeader::getFieldName() removed | |
| A | ↛ | TrailerHeader::getFieldName() removed | |
| A | ↛ | AccessControlMaxAgeHeader::getFieldValue() removed | |
| A | ↛ | SetCookieHeader::validateCookieName() removed | |
| A | ↛ | InvalidStreamException::noResource() removed | |
| A | ↛ | Header::validateQuotedString() removed | |
| ⋮ | view more | ||